Facilities ticket — Halewick Tower, night shift.

Issue: support team reporting east stairwell reader rejecting badges after midnight. Reader was reset this morning; firmware updated. Overnight crew should now badge as normal. If the reader fails again, use the manual keypad by the fire door — do not prop the door. Log any further failures with the time and badge name. Temporary keypad code for the fallback door is below.

door code, tajeg-fawip: bdg-K-62

Handover note for the Quillgate API pagination work — passing this to you before review, Tomas. Cursor-based pagination is done; the tricky bit is that cursors encode a sort key plus a tiebreaker ID, so any new sortable field needs both. Offset pagination is deprecated but still served for legacy clients until Q3. Please scrutinize the cursor-expiry logic especially. Design rationale and edge cases are written up on the internal page here:

operations page: https://vault.qirvanhq.local/ticket

**Internal Memo — Halverin Launch Plan**

As incoming director, please review the staged rollout for the Halverin 2 platform. Phase one targets the Ostbridge and Canner Vale markets, with trained support teams in place two weeks before release. Pricing, channel agreements with Durnow Retail, and the revised warranty terms are finalized; packaging approval from Tessa Morrow's group is the last open item. Timelines are deliberately conservative. The confidential note on related business plans appears directly beneath this memo.

board note of kageg-bahof: The renewal with Holwynax Holdings closes at $2 million a year, 5 percent below the last contract. Project Ulaath slips by two quarters because of the supplier delay.

## Formula sandbox tuning

User-supplied formulas in Gridmoor execute inside a restricted interpreter with hard ceilings on time, memory, and call depth. Reviewers should confirm any change to these ceilings is justified in the PR description, since raising them widens the abuse surface. Defaults were chosen from production traces. The current limits are as follows.

limits module of tafog-fawip:
WEIGHTS = {
    "julix": 57,
    "lamys": 992,
    "kasvan": 209,
    "quenok": 750,
    "alddor": 259,
    "oliath": 1009,
    "wenix": 815,
}